Introduction: Hypokalemic periodic paralysis (HPP) is a severe yet reversible neuromuscular condition precipitated by profound hypokalemia. Autoimmune disorders can exacerbate renal potassium loss resulting in abrupt muscle weakness. Primary Sjögren's syndrome (pSS), an autoimmune disease characterized by exocrine gland insufficiency, can lead to renal tubular dysfunction and episodes of HPP when distal acidification is compromised.

Eosinophilic fasciitis involves collagenous thickening of the subcutaneous fascia, hypergammaglobulinaemia, and peripheral eosinophilia, manifesting as erythema and oedema of the extremities and trunk. Rarely, it coexists with systemic lupus erythematosus. Eosinophilic fasciitis mimics scleroderma, making early diagnosis crucial.

A previously healthy 16-year-old female presented with acute onset of signs and symptoms of headache, nausea, sweating, abdominal pain, palpitations, chest pain, hypertension, and tachycardia. The patient was admitted to the pediatric critical care unit and rapidly progressed to cardiorespiratory failure, necessitating veno-arterial extracorporeal membrane oxygenation (VA ECMO) as a life-saving measure. After three days of ECMO support, complicated by arterial thrombi to the left lower limb, necessitating below-knee amputation, the patient was weaned off ECMO and ventilator support.

View Article and Find Full Text PDFIn nature, terpene nucleosides are relatively rare, with 1-tuberculosinyladenosine (1-TbAd) being an exclusive feature of Mycobacterium tuberculosis (Mtb). The convergence of nucleosides and terpene pathways in the Mtb complex appears to have emerged late in its evolutionary history. 1-TbAd (PDB ID: 3WQK) is a prominent chemical marker for Mtb and may contribute to its virulence-related properties when exported extracellularly.
View Article and Find Full Text PDFRecent studies have proposed that Trichomonas vaginalis, the causative agent of trichomoniasis [the most common nonviral sexually transmitted infection (STI) in humans] can establish persistent infections in the vagina. T. vaginalis infections are often asymptomatic but can have adverse consequences such as increased risk of HIV-1 infection and cervical cancer.
